Rejected petition Government to debate ability for Police Officers to reject Police Federation

More details

Police are facing more and more new proposals to change the way in which they work. Whilst many of these proposals are welcome, the majority are not and are being raced through without proper consultation with officers. Many officer's feel that the Federation have not supported them properly over many issues and seek a change to the current situation of not being allowed to choose who represents their interests.

To move to another staff support mechanism would allow officers to have confidence in who represents them at all levels.

The new staff support system, or the choice of a current established staff union would only be able to work within the current 'framework' of Police Regulations etc and therefore industrial rights for example would remain unchanged unless further legislation was considered.
